All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/ _______________________________________________ HARRY F. MERRILL Harry F. Merrill, 73, of RD 3, Rawlings, Md., died Sunday, Nov. 29, 1987, in Memorial Hospital. He was born May 31, 1914 in Merrill, the son of the late James and Mary D. (Hummell) Merrill. He was retired from Browning Foodland, Westernport, Md., where he had worked as produced manager. He is survived by his widow, Shirley E. (Ketterman) Merrill; five sons, Wayne F. Merrill, Cumberland, Md.; David K. Merrill, Easton, Tex.; Allen L. Merrill, at home; Steven D. Merrill and Paul E. Merrill, both of Richmond, Va.; four daughters, Mrs. Karen Shoemaker, Rawlings, Md.; Mrs. Kathy Broadwater, Richmond, Va.; Mrs. Wendy R. Orosco, Cumberland, Md.; and Miss Bonnie R. Merrill, at home; two brothers, James "Junior" Merrill, Cumberland, Md.; and Paul Merrill, Oakland, Md.; a sister, Mrs. Nira Brown, Salisbury; seven grandchildren; and two great-grandchildren. Friends were received at the Scarpelli Funeral Home where services were conducted Wednesday at 1 p.m. by the Rev. B. Spencer Brozozog. Interment, Sunset Memorial Park. The Republic, December 3, 1987 [M1138]
